Webb21 juni 2024 · The flow in a piping system is largely determined by the available energy and the losses in the pipes. This energy could be provided by gravity or/and by a pump. In the case of gravity-fed systems, only gravity is used to transport water (or other fluid) from a source to a final application. WebbWhat you want is the Hazen-Williams equation. You will need the coefficient for the type of pipe, pipe ID, and also equivalent pipe lengths for each bend in the system, which you will add to the pipe length. Flexible pipe will make this difficult, but you will have to know or estimate the curves. Set the head loss to h4 + h3 and solve for flow ...
